The following instructions shows exactly how to charge your mobile phone when you're visiting Israel using their types M, C or H Israeli 220 volt 50Hz plug outlets, Type H power outlets will be typically used by a majority of Israelis. When you are visiting Israel from another country please make sure your mobile phone can be used with a 220v supply. If the mobile phone came from a country which uses a lower voltage (for example 110v) check your mobile phone is dual voltage (marked with 100-240 volts) else you may need to use an additional transformer to avoid the device from being damaged during charging.

How to use a Type C power charger for recharging your mobile phone from an Israeli power outlet

Charging any mobile phone from an Israeli power outlet by using a 3 pinned Type H USB adapter

Using type B Micro USB cord and a 3 pinned Type H power charger to recharge any mobile phone with an Israeli power outlet.

  1. To supply power to your mobile phone from the Israeli power outlet you'll need a Type H USB power plug adapter [6] and a USB 2.0 A Male to Micro B cable [4].
  2. Insert the Type H USB power plug adapter in the Israeli power outlet. You can identify the plug supply by three thin slots pointing inward in a triangle shape. More recently made type H power outlets also have rounded holes in the middle of each slot to accommodate the round pinned Type C plugs that are used in over 100 other countries. Type H electrical sockets are the most commonly used outlets in Israel.

Charging any mobile phone from an Israeli power outlet by using a 3 pinned Type M USB adapter

Using type B Micro USB cord with a Type M power charger to charge any mobile phone with an Israeli power outlet.

  1. To supply power to your mobile phone from the Israeli power outlet you will need a Type M USB power plug adapter [8] and a USB 2.0 A Male to Micro B cable [4].
  2. Begin the process by plugging the Type M USB power plug adapter in the Israeli power outlet. You can identify the plug outlet by 3 large round holes forming a triangle configuration for live, neutral and ground pins. These sockets aren't as commonplace in Israel. These outlets are being phased out in Israel in favour of Type H power outlets and are only typically used with high wattage equipment.
